The Meaning of ‘Om’
“Om” isn’t just a sound. Tradition calls it the original vibration of the universe—the pulse that underlies everything. It stands for creation, balance, and the cycles of life. When you chant it, you’re actually pronouncing three sounds—A, U, and M. Each one lines up with a different state of consciousness: waking, dreaming, and deep sleep.Put them together, and you get a vibration that seems to reach right into your mind and spirit.

You don’t need any special tools or training. Just a quiet spot and a few minutes.
- Sit up straight, wherever you’re comfortable.
- Take a slow, full breath in.
- As you let it out, chant “Au…” and ease into “Mmm…” at the end.
- Feel the vibration moving through your chest, throat, and head.
- Repeat 5 to 10 times, or as long as it feels good.
- Even a couple of minutes can shift your mood.
